The Berlin-Barcelona Initiative is a European public health initiative I am developing as a passionate amateur triathlete who became an Ironman in 2024 (Altriman ultra-IM), and researcher at the Berlin Institute of Health at Charité. I find great meaning in combining physical challenges with the causes that matter most to me and my loved ones: health, science, and the environment. This journey is a holistic challenge shaped by my experiences that helped me empirically forge myself through life challenges, encounters and opportunities. Raising awareness, understanding, and connecting humans assembles a thriving society. I genuinely believe in the power of role models, which is why I want this initiative to serve as a platform to share the stories of extraordinary individuals I admire.

Impact & Goals

At each stop along the way, events will be organized to raise public awareness and foster dialogue among citizens, scientists, and policymakers. A series of podcasts and a documentary will amplify the voices of experts, athletes, and advocates to ensure a lasting impact from this initiative.
